7/25/2019 9:28am It's funny, people often say they "want better damping" as if for example a more expensive fork is going to inherently have damping that "feels smoother" or whatever. If you look at how hydraulic damping actually works, you'll soon understand that more damping will always equal a harsher ride, especially when talking about any kind of high-speed suspension event (talking about shaft speed, not the speed of the bike although the two are often related). Damping in and of itself is not something "smooth", even though it involves moving oil around. A spring is something very dynamic. It resists compression...

7/25/2019 9:12am Allen, you referenced adding spacers to increase mid-stroke support--that's not true and wanted to point it out just to clarify for other readers. It's important to point out the myth (that I've heard repeated in Youtube videos and in written web articles) that adding tokens is for mid-stroke. .... Adding Tokens/spacers have very minimal effect on the mid-stroke. They affect and are used for ramp up the latter third of the travel. If you add spacers and keep your pressure the same, it may feel like there is more mid-stroke support (there definitely is not less!). That said, the point...
